How much was ten shillings worth?
Ten shillings in £sd (written 10s or 10/–) was half of one pound. The ten-shilling note was the smallest denomination note ever issued by the Bank of England. The note was issued by the Bank of England for the first time in 1928 and continued to be printed until 1969.
How much is a 10 bob note?
Back in the 1960’s the 10 Shilling Note, or ‘ten bob’ as it was commonly known, would go pretty far – buying you 6 pints of beer, 10 loaves of bread, or 17 pints of milk. Nowadays it’s hard to imagine the decimal equivalent, the 50p, buying so much.
How much is an Australian 10 pound note worth?
The Australian ten-pound note was a denomination of the Australian pound that was equivalent to twenty dollars on 14 February 1966. This denomination along with all other pound denomination is still legal tender = twenty dollar note.

How much was a shilling worth?
twelve pence
The shilling (1/- or 1s.) was a coin worth one twentieth of a pound sterling, or twelve pence.
